Education: Out of Pocket

It is not exactly news that higher education has big money troubles. The pleading letters to alumni, as well as a number of studies, have proclaimed that many of the nation's universities and colleges have deep financial problems. But the magnitude of the crisis has been difficult to assess owing to the limited number of institutions surveyed. Now, the most comprehensive national study to date has been made by the New Jersey Commission on Financing Post-Secondary Education for the September issue of Change magazine.
